At CARIAD, we're bundling and further expanding the Volkswagen Group's software expertise. We’re uniting over 6,500 global experts to build a scalable technology stack, including a software platform, unified electronic architecture and reliable connection to the automotive cloud. Our CARIDIANS are developing vehicle functions such as driver assistance systems, a next-generation infotainment platform, power electronics and charging technology, and digital services in and around the vehicle.
Our software can already be found in Volkswagen ID. models and will soon power Audi and Porsche vehicles with the E3 1.2 platform in 2024.

The area of "Architecture & Technologies" is CARIAD's mobility backbone and it constitutes the interface to vehicle mechatronics in the Volkswagen Group. Our organization spearheads the transformation from a traditional manufacturing company to a software-driven tech player. In doing so, we enable innovations from the vehicle to the off-board as the basis for future applications ranging from climate control to infotainment and autonomous driving. You will work in agile teams and contribute to the development of the next generation of E/E and software architecture. Our division is responsible for the consistent and efficient design and implementation of the architecture. Consequently, we directly impact the driving and user/customer experience in and around the car by reducing complexity and ensuring efficiency. We specify, develop, model, test, calibrate, evaluate and design innovative technology requirements that fascinate our customers.
